It seems we are constantly being given choices about with whom to spend time and how we wish to spend that time. There are so many opportunities for activities that we could be busy all the time, if we wished. Many object that they don’t have a partner or they don’t have the money to do things but there are many activities that do not require money or a partner. We are always at the point of choice about how we are spending our time.
We might have a job where the people do not feel supportive, but we are choosing to work there for the paycheck or the prestige or whatever the reason is, including that there are not very many other jobs. Or we might be out of work at the moment wishing that we had a job to complain about but perhaps this is the Universe’s way to protect us from being around a vibration that is toxic to us and to our spiritual and personal growth. Maybe you are in a relationship with friends, a partner, a family member and that relationship seems to drag you down or keep you from moving forward as you like. Perhaps the food you are eating makes you feel heavier instead of lighter, and we are not discussing weight here, but how you feel, what your vibration is.
Consider that the vibratory frequency of Love is a high vibration. It becomes a conscious choice for awakened individuals to move their own vibration to this level. It doesn’t happen by accident for adults who are dragging a lot of Life’s baggage around with them. And this level of Love vibration starts with loving oneself.
Is all this talk of ‘Love vibration’ starting to sound like the Summer of ’69 talk to you? Think about what was happening then, beyond Woodstock and drugs. There was a feeling that we all need a way to feel peaceful. We need to learn to love each other and ourselves. People were trying out communal living as a way to band together with like-minded individuals and create community. We were all searching for something, at least, those of us who were alive then were searching.
Maybe we have become more sophisticated since then or maybe we have become distracted, but now we have an understanding about how to gain that peaceful feeling. And we can create community on the Internet or at spiritual centers or by gathering like-minded people together without having to live in a commune.
We can meditate, individually or in a group, and raise our own vibration. We can teach our children to meditate so that they have a tool to overcome the denseness of the world. We can talk with others about loftier topics than the weather or the latest reality TV show. These are all choices. We can watch movies that make us feel good, whether with Netflix or On Demand or in a theater, and we can share the experience with others. Book clubs abound now with people wanting to have discussions, to gather around a topic and discuss ideas rather than other people.
Love yourself. Start there to focus on raising your own vibration. Love yourself enough to pay attention to the signals that you intuitively feel about people, places, entertainment, food. Open your heart to those around you, not to allow yourself to be demeaned or abused but to genuinely start with Love in your heart for ALL around you. And then make a determination about how you feel in the presence of others. Decide consciously whether or not to spend time with them. Decide how you feel about a proposed activity – are you going along with the crowd or does it really feel like something you wish to spend your precious time participating in? And then think about the food and drink that you put in your body. Take a moment before you eat to really assess how you feel about ingesting that food. Get yourself relaxed and peaceful before you eat anything so that you can be conscious about eating.
Try all this and see how you feel a month from now!
